ESRX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

1,109 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Express Scripts Holding Company (ESRX)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$38.1B — up 12% from $34B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 85 funds closed out of ESRX and 82 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 463 trimmed existing stakes and 337 added.

The largest buyer was Farallon Capital Management, adding an estimated $504M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$536M.
